About the Illustrator: Since 1997, R. W. Alley has been the illustrator for the Paddington Bear books. The series is co-published in the US and England and available in foreign language editions throughout Europe. The books are all written by Paddington's creator, Michael Bond. Some are well known Paddington stories and many are brand-new adventures.


R. W. Alley writes "Many other artists have drawn, and I knew would draw, Paddington and it was not an easy thing to figure out how to make my interpretation have a life of its own. And, I had to audition my drawings for Mr. Bond, himself. Luckily, not unlike the Londoners Paddington meets, especially those along Portobello Road, Michael Bond is an extremely pleasant gentleman. He asked me to reconsider only several of my drawings. Since I had brought my paper and paints with me to London, this was not too difficult. In the end, Michael approved letting me try to picture Paddington. So far, so good. To date I have illustrated almost 20 of Mr. Bond's books about Paddington."
